The Benefits of Using Advanced Home Health Services for Elderly Care

As the population ages, senior care becomes an increasingly important issue for families. Many seniors prefer to live at home rather than in a nursing home or assisted living facility, but they may require additional care and support. That’s where advanced home health services come in.

What Are Advanced Home Health Services?

Advanced home health services provide medical and non-medical care to seniors in their homes. This type of care may include skilled nursing, physical therapy, occupational therapy, speech therapy, medication management, assistive technology, and personal care assistance.

Benefits of Using Advanced Home Health Services for Elderly Care

There are many benefits to using advanced home health services for elderly care:

1. Safer Environment

Elderly individuals are more prone to falls and accidents, often due to mobility issues, balance problems, and other health conditions. Advanced home health services can provide a safer environment for seniors by installing safety equipment, providing mobility aids, and helping with activities of daily living to reduce the risk of accidents and improve quality of life.

2. Personalized Care

One of the biggest advantages of advanced home health services is the personalized care that seniors receive. Unlike in a nursing home or assisted living facility, seniors receive one-on-one attention from experienced caregivers who are trained to address their unique needs and preferences. Care plans can be personalized to the individual’s medical condition and situation, ensuring that they receive the best possible care.

3. More Affordable Care

Advanced home health services are often more affordable than nursing home or assisted living care. This is because seniors can receive the care they need in their own homes, rather than paying for the additional expenses associated with a nursing home or assisted living facility.

4. Increased Family Involvement

When seniors receive advanced home health services, family members can be more involved in their care. This can provide a sense of comfort and reassurance for seniors, while also reducing caregiver stress. Family involvement can also improve communication between caregivers and healthcare providers, leading to better outcomes.

5. Improved Quality of Life

Advanced home health services can improve the quality of life for seniors by providing care that allows them to maintain their independence and dignity. This type of care can also lead to better health outcomes, such as improved mobility, reduced pain, and better management of chronic conditions.

Conclusion

Advanced home health services provide a safe, personalized, affordable, and high-quality option for elderly care. As the population ages, more and more families are turning to this type of care to provide their loved ones with the support they need to age in place with dignity and independence.
